Korean nano-materials company developing large-area AAO (Anodized Aluminum Oxide) membranes for 3D silicon capacitors targeting AI accelerators, HBM, and high-capacity semiconductor applications Hexapro was founded in 2022. The company is led by Kim Taesun. Based in Ansan-si, Gyeonggi-do, South Korea. Team size: 1-10. Total funding raised: $1.6M. Latest round: Series A. Key investors include LF Investment, TIPS (Tech Incubator Program for Startups).

Value proposition

Proprietary AAO membrane technology that enables 3D silicon capacitors with 1,000x surface area expansion vs. planar structures, reducing MLCC count from 10-20 to 1, at less than 1/3 the conventional cost through reusable aluminum substrate technology

Products and solutions

AAO Membrane, AAO Powder, AAO Polymer Composite Film, V Shape AAO on Al, 3D Silicon Capacitor solutions using through-hole AAO for trench MIM capacitors

Unique value

World's first 8-inch large-area through-hole AAO membrane with reusable substrate technology, cutting supply cost to under 1/3 of conventional methods while enabling ultra-high-capacity 3D capacitors for AI chips

Technology advantage

Proprietary AAO separation technology that peels AAO layer from aluminum substrate allowing substrate reuse (50-100 sheets per piece vs. 1); first to achieve 8-inch large-area through-hole AAO; 1,000x surface area expansion for 3D capacitors; cost reduction to under 1/3 of conventional methods; 9 patents; selected for 9.0 billion won MSIT nanoscale materials R&D project

How they differentiate

Unlike conventional AAO manufacturing that requires melt-away process (single-use, expensive), Hexapro's separation technology enables substrate reuse and large-area production. Their AAO-based 3D silicon capacitors can replace 10-20 MLCCs with a single component, challenging market leaders like Murata with more economical and efficient materials.
